Leviticus 15:2–3
A connected passage, with study helps kept beside the verses they explain.
Leviticus 15:2
2Speak unto the children of Israel, and say unto them, When any man hath a running issue out of his flesh, because of his issue he is unclean.
2Speake vnto the children of Israel, and say vnto them, when any man hath a ‖running issue out of his flesh, because of his issue he is vncleane.
- Or, running of the reines.
Leviticus 15:3
3And this shall be his uncleanness in his issue: whether his flesh run with his issue, or his flesh be stopped from his issue, it is his uncleanness.
3And this shall be his vncleannesse in his issue: whether his flesh run with his issue, or his flesh be stopped from his issue, it is his vncleannesse.
